source M3U urls https://iptv-org.github.io/iptv/index.m3u https://iptv-org.github.io/iptv/index.country.m3u (grouped by country) https://iptv-org.github.io/iptv/index.category.m3u (grouped by category) https://iptv-org.github.io/iptv/index.language.m3u (grouped by language) https://iptv-org.github.io/iptv/index.nsfw.m3u (includes adult channels) https://iptv-org.github.io/iptv/categories/xxx.m3u https://github.com/iptv-org/awesome-iptv To do this, you just have to make a GET request to: https://iptv-org.github.io/iptv/channels.json